    Did you have to put the car in service mode to replace the back because of the electronic parking brake?

    • @TerenceDIY
      @TerenceDIY  25 дней назад +1

      This vehicle was not equipped with electronic parking brakes. However, if your vehicle is equipped with it, then yes you will have to put the vehicle in service mode.
      Instructions from my software...
      - Ignition on, engine off.
      - Press on service brake pedal.
      - While holding pedal down, push down on the park brake switch for 15 seconds.
      - A flashing letter P with a wrench symbol will appear in the display.
      When you're done changing the brakes, place your foot on the pedal and pull up on the park brake switch.
